I’ve had pretty good luck with full force diesels up pipes but I’d say next best option is most definitely riffraff diesel ones. This truck just got manifolds full force up pipes and riffraff intake and plenum boots. Along with a set of 160/30 rosewood diesel injectors. Motorcraft glow plugs and Dorman valve cover gaskets. I can say from experience that any exhaust leak pre turbo will definitely cause a lose in power.

Installed drivers side up pipe yesterday. Hardest part of the job was letting tranny down so I could get pipe out. Supposed to “slide out from below”, but seemed to get nowhere until I lowered trans.

Left passenger side for another day, as it is NOT currently leaking. Attached up pipe to baby’s butt first (as per Riff Raff’s instructions) and tightened manifold to up pipe last. Was a thin gap at pipe to manifold junction that I closed up by tightening bolts. Did the bellows stretch out a bit to accommodate that? Assuming so…

No real pull yet, but boost doesn’t seem any better and EGTs the same. No exhaust leak however.

I am going to hook on to the trailer in the next couple of days and give it a go. But if no change going to order a KC 300x Stage 1.

What should I be seeing for boost on a healthy stock system at 3,000? Will the 300x give more boost? If so, what kind of PSI should I expect at 3,000?

I was around 15psi I think on stock injectors, ZF (in OD) 4.10:1 gears, and 30.5" tall tires. ICP and IPR good.

Manifolds leak, check there too. My driver side popped a leak so I have slightly elevated EGTs now.
